Industry description

Food distributors function as intermediaries between food manufacturers and food service operators (such as chefs, restaurants, beverage managers, cafeterias, industrial caterers, hospitals and nursing homes). Food distribution companies buy, store and then supply food items to the food service operators, thereby allowing the latter to have access to a wide range of food items from various manufacturers. Sysco Corporation, US Foods Holding Corp. and Herbalife Nutrition Ltd. are some of the biggest (by market cap) U.S. companies in this segment. Most food service operators buy from local, specialty, and/or broad line food service distributors on a daily or weekly basis. With the rise in e-commerce, consumers are increasingly expecting lower prices, faster service, and higher quality – something that potentially creates the impetus on distribution networks to raise their game.
